Light Apple Pecan Crisp
Servings:
4
large servings / 6 small servings
Ingredients
1
tsp.
ground cinnamon
1/4
tsp.
ground nutmeg
2
Tbsp.
granulated sugar
2
Tbsp.
all-purpose flour
3
Granny smith apples
cored, sliced thin
Topping:
1/3
cup
quick oats
1/4
cup
crushed shortbread cookies
about 3 / recommended: Walker’s Shortbread
1
Tbsp.
chopped pecans
1
tsp.
ground cinnamon
2
Tbsp.
brown sugar
1
tsp.
pure vanilla extract
2
Tbsp.
unsalted butter
softened
Instructions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
Mix cinnamon, nutmeg, sugar and flour in a large bowl. Toss in sliced apples and coat evenly. Place apples into a 9-inch square or round baking dish.
In the same bowl, combine topping ingredients and mix by hand until crumbly. Sprinkle topping over the apples.
Bake until topping is golden brown, 25-30 minutes. Test by inserting a toothpick; it should come out clean and not pick up the apple slices.
Serve with vanilla whipped cream, ice cream or frozen yogurt. To store, cover dish with plastic wrap and refrigerate up to 4 days.
